How long is the US Coast Guard Academy?
seven-week
Incoming cadets are required to participate in Swab Summer, a seven-week military training program. Student life is highly regimented at the Coast Guard Academy, with military training, study periods and athletic activities all built into the daily schedule.

Is the US Coast Guard Academy free?
The Coast Guard Academy (CGA) is one of the five federal service academies. The CGA is tuition free and cadets also earn a modest paycheck.
